Publisher's summary

It's been exactly two years since Katie and her aunt and uncle opened the Honeybee Bakery, where they serve delicious - and bespelled - treats to the good people of Savannah. After a dinner celebrating the bakery's anniversary, they all take a stroll along the waterfront and meet Aunt Lucy's friend Orla, a colorful character who has been telling the fortunes of locals and tourists alike for years.

The next day, Orla meets with what seems like a terrible accident, but Katie's witchy intuition tells her it was something more sinister. Together with her trustworthy coven and her firefighter boyfriend, she'll race to find out what happened to the unfortunate fortune-teller before the piping hot trail goes cold....

Another good story

Katie is growing more comfortable with who and what she is, learning to channel her energy and power, which is nice. Although her life seems a tad boring to her, it is never boring to us. Declan, what a sweetie, we all need a Declan in our lives. Detective Quinn...surprise!
If you’ve enjoyed Katie’s previous adventures, trials and tribulations, you will certainly enjoy this one.
For those of you that enjoy sizzling sex, action and high adventure, this is not for you. This is slow, low key adventure and wholesome fun.
